How does a wash rack water recycling system work? The process begins by collecting wastewater that flows off vehicles during the washing process. This collected water often contains various pollutants that need to be filtered out. The system utilizes several stages of treatment to ensure that the water is clean and safe for reuse. Typically, the first step involves a sedimentation process where heavier particles settle at the bottom of a tank. Following this, the water undergoes filtration and biological treatment to remove contaminants effectively.

One of the best features of neoprene wellingtons is their flexibility and comfort. Unlike traditional rubber boots, neoprene wellingtons are soft and pliable, making them easy to move in and comfortable to wear for long periods of time. The insulating properties of neoprene also help to regulate the temperature inside the boots, keeping your feet warm in cold weather and cool in hot weather.
